Home Water Filtration in Monmouth County, NJ
Home water filtration services involve installing systems that improve the quality and safety of a household’s drinking water. These projects typically include assessing the existing water supply, selecting appropriate filtration units such as reverse osmosis, carbon filters, or sediment filters, and installing them to reduce contaminants like chlorine, lead, bacteria, and sediments. Homeowners often seek these services to ensure their family has access to clean, fresh-tasting water, or to address specific concerns such as hard water buildup or unpleasant odors. Before requesting a water filtration system, property owners usually want to understand the current water quality, the types of contaminants present, and the most suitable filtration options for their household needs.
Property owners considering water filtration services should be aware of the different system types available and how they can benefit their home. It’s common to inquire about the maintenance requirements, lifespan of the filtration units, and any potential impact on water pressure or flow. Understanding the scope of the project, including whether existing plumbing needs modifications or upgrades, helps in planning for a successful installation. Clarifying these details ensures that the chosen filtration system effectively addresses specific water quality concerns and fits within the household’s usage patterns.

Common Home Water Filtration Jobs
Whole House Water Filtration - improves water quality for all taps and appliances in the home.
Point-of-Use Filtration Systems - provides targeted filtration at a specific faucet or fixture.
Sediment and Particulate Removal - reduces dirt, rust, and debris from household water supplies.
Water Softening Systems - helps to reduce hard water buildup and mineral deposits.
UV Water Purification - eliminates bacteria and viruses for safer drinking water.
Filtration System Maintenance - ensures continued performance and water quality over time.
Home Water Filtration Questions
What is home water filtration? Home water filtration involves installing systems that remove contaminants and improve water quality for household use.
What types of water filtration systems are available? Common options include point-of-use filters, whole-house systems, and reverse osmosis units, each targeting different impurities.
How do I know if my water needs filtration? Signs include unusual taste, odor, discoloration, or if testing reveals high levels of certain minerals or contaminants.
What benefits does water filtration provide? It can enhance water taste, reduce impurities, and support better overall water quality for drinking and household use.
